Uremia itself is not contagious. However, uremia has many underlying causes. Primary chronic glomerulonephritis, tubulointerstitial nephritis, and renal vascular diseases are non-infectious. In contrast, uremia may also result from infectious diseases such as genitourinary tuberculosis, HIV/AIDS, and syphilis; patients with uremia secondary to these infections are contagious and require isolation. Additionally, hepatitis B and hepatitis C can lead to hepatitis B– or C–associated nephropathy; such patients are also contagious, primarily via blood exposure and close contact.
